About the teamAn amazing opportunity to join a talented team maintaining the FIS Flagship Transaction Debit Processing Switch; Connex on HP Nonstop. Leveraging Safe Agile framework to provide innovative data solutions driving real business value to both our internal and external customers. Job DescriptionA multifaceted Processor Interface (PI) software developer position with a high degree of responsibility and a broad spectrum of opportunities.

What you will be doingAssigned to a scrum team consisting of project manager/scrum master, developers, business analysts, and quality control testers.Analyzes, designs, programs, debugs, modifies, and unit tests software enhancements and/or new products.Takes personal responsibility for quality of individual deliverables and contributes to the quality assurance of the team's deliverables.

Interacts with product managers and/or users to define system requirements and/or modifications.Participates in all Agile team meetings and ceremonies.Creates and revises all technical documentation related to coding and development.

Trains new or junior developers on aspects of an application or system and development processes.What you bringBachelor's degree in computer engineering, computer science, or other related discipline or the equivalent combination of education, training, or work experience.Experience with HP NonStop/Tandem development with skills in performing requirement analysis, design, and coding in Connex or Base24.

Programming experience with TAL, pTAL languages.Experience with Enscribe and SQL systems.Business knowledge and understanding of Debit Card payment processing environment and transaction processing.

Experience with Scaled Agile Framework for Enterprises (SAFe).Attention to detail, diligence, and accuracy.Excellent customer service skills that build high levels of customer satisfaction for internal and external clients.

Exceptional analytical, decision-making, problem-solving, and time management skills to ensure critical deadlines are met.Willingness to share relevant technical and/or industry knowledge and expertise to other resources.A resourceful and proactive approach in gathering information and sharing ideas.
